International Criminal Court Prosecutor Fatou Bensouda has announced about a preliminary investigation in Gabon in regard with unrests that took place during protests over the election results, reports the AFP. According to him, the government of Gabon has appealed to start investigation immediately, accusing the opposition leader of the country of inciting crimes against humanity and genocide. He said that the office will make a preliminary examination to determine whether there is enough evidence for a full investigation.
